Argos

Argos is a UK retail chain, offers an extensive range of general merchandise on its in-store and online networks. Customers can shop online, via mobile channels, at 850 stores, Swag Fabrication Tools or over the phone. The company also offers home delivery services, as well as click and pick up.

Argos has a reputation as one of the most well-known catalogue stores in the UK. Traditionally, the process of shopping consisted of filling out a tiny order form that contained the catalogue numbers of the items that you want. In the past, customers were handed red pencils at the shops. The forms were later taken to the check-out and paid for, with an invoice indicating where the customer should wait for their items to be delivered from the storeroom.

Debenhams

The first Debenhams store opened in 1778 on Wigmore Street in the heart of London's West End. The company expanded, opening new stores throughout the UK. The company has changed its name a number of times, most recently from Clark & Debenhams to Debenhams and Freebody.

After the war, the business grew quickly. In 1920, Harvey Nichols, a Knightsbridge retailer, was acquired. While operating under the Debenhams brand, the stores were independent. However purchasing and vimeo.Com warehousing was centralized.

In 1985, the Burton Group acquired the brand. Later, Arcadia merged with it. In 1998, the retailer separated from the Burton Group and returned to an exchange listing. In the noughties, Belinda Earl was appointed chief executive and introduced exclusive designer clothes under the Designers at Debenhams label. The company launched its first store outside London at Cheltenham.

John Lewis

The John Lewis Partnership, a British department-store chain, has 52 stores. Including the flagship Oxford Street store and the Peter Jones branch in Sloane Square, London, 35 of these are traditional department stores, and Vimeo 12 are "John Lewis at Home' homeware and furniture outlets. The partnership also operates two Food Halls within its stores in addition to the Waitrose brand of products that are its own.

In 1933, John Lewis purchased its first store outside London. It was an Jessops in Nottingham. The partnership expanded further in the 1940s by purchasing Selfridge's Provincial Stores, a group of provincial and suburban department stores.

House of Fraser

Established in 1849, House of Fraser (HoF) is the most well-known department store chain. It has numerous branches and offers homeware and clothing. It was purchased in 2018 by Sports Direct founder Mike Ashley However, the company faces several challenges.

One of them is Brexit which has caused economic uncertainty and reduced consumer spending. It's tough to compete with online retailers. Costs for shipping and fluctuations in currency have hurt the company's sales.

Mike Ashley, owner of Sports Direct, saved the flagship 318 Oxford Street branch from closure in 2018. The new owners are planning to transform the Art Deco building into a mix of offices, shops and a rooftop restaurant. HoF's parent company, Fraser Group, blames archaic business rates for its troubles and warns that further closures will be inevitable if there isn't a change.

A.O.

AO is one of the largest companies to emerge from the North West in the last 20 years. The Bolton-based firm, founded by John Roberts, is listed on the London Stock Exchange and specialises in electronic and white goods. The company, initially called Appliances Online was founded after Roberts won PS1 in a bet with a buddy that he would alter the way that white appliances were bought online. Since then, the company has expanded into AO Business, AO Finance and AO Mobile. It also offers an in-house delivery system and its own recycling plant for fridges.
